What are the specific considerations for franchise sales contracts in Ecuador?

In franchise sales contracts, it is essential to address specific aspects. The contract may detail the rights and obligations of the franchisor and franchisee, including terms of use of the brand, royalty payments, support provided, and conditions for renewing or terminating the franchise. It is also important to comply with the specific regulations for franchises in Ecuador.

What is the impact of internet fraud on the competitiveness of Brazilian companies in the global market?

Internet fraud can affect the competitiveness of Brazilian companies in the global market by raising concerns about the security of online commercial transactions, the protection of intellectual property and the reliability of digital services offered by Brazilian companies, which can diminish their ability to compete with companies from other countries.
